王美琴
(浙江同濟科技職業學院,浙江 杭州 311231)
基于.NET的通用數據庫轉換系統的設計與實現
王美琴
(浙江同濟科技職業學院,浙江 杭州 311231)
在信息化時代,企業面對爆發式的數據增長和各種新應用的出現,隨著數據庫應用環境復雜性的增加,數據庫的結構和管理系統發生很大的變化,而歷史數據的價值不容忽視,因此企業越來越重視不同數據庫的數據轉換問題。本文針對現有數據轉換系統的研究現狀與存在問題,在結合ADO.NET與XML的基礎上,設計了一種靈活、通用、高效、可靠的通用數據庫轉換系統。系統分為數據庫配置與轉換兩大功能模塊,用戶通過簡單的交互操作就可以完成復雜的數據庫之間的數據遷移與數據結構轉換。本系統已在某水利信息系統升級中得到了實際應用。
數據轉換;數據遷移;ADO.NET;XML
隨著大數據的蓬勃發展,數據平臺建設已經被各企業提上日程而且需要不斷更新換代。在企業發展過程中,不同信息系統可能使用不同數據庫系統,信息系統更新的同時有時也需要更新數據庫管理工具或重新設計數據庫結構,當舊數據與新數據所使用的數據庫不同時,數據庫轉換就變得很有必要。現有的數據庫轉換工具往往只具有單純將舊數據庫已存在的數據進行遷移的功能,而無法對數據進行按需修改或者無法實時自動對新讀入的數據進行轉換。本文旨在討論一種對數據庫進行智能轉換的系統設計與實現的方法,使數據庫轉換更加方便和高效。……